Namuhla, sithole impendulo evela kumakhasimende ethu ase-Korea.Esigabeni sokukhetha, ikhasimende licele i-3-phase 150aisilawuli samandlangokuxhunywa kweheater kanxantathu.Ngokuhlaziywa kwesidingo, sinikeza amakhasimende ngochungechunge lwethu lwe-NK30T-150-0.4izilawuli zamandla ezigaba ezintathu.Uchungechunge lwe-NK30T lwe-thyristor power regulator ukusebenza njengoba ngezansi:
1. Ukusebenza okuphezulu okwakhelwe ngaphakathi, isilawuli esincane samandla amancane;
2. Izici ze-peripheral;
2.1.Ukusekela 4-20mA kanye 0-5V/10v ezimbili inikezwe;
2.2.Okokufaka okubili kokushintsha;
2.3.Ibanga elibanzi le-primary loop voltage (AC110--440V);
3. Isixazululo sokupholisa esisebenzayo, usayizi omncane kangako, isisindo esilula;
4. Umsebenzi we-alamu osebenzayo;
4.1.Ukuhluleka kwesigaba;
4.2.Ukushisa ngokweqile;
4.3 I-Overcurrent;
4.4.Ikhefu lokulayisha;
5. Okukhiphayo okudluliswayo okukodwa, 3A AC250V, 3A DC30V;
6. Ukwenza lula ukulawula okumaphakathi RS485 ukuxhumana;
Ikhasimende lisebenzisa isikrini sokuthinta se-Delta ukuze lihlanganyele nesilawuli samandla ngesixhumi esibonakalayo se-RS485.I-voltage yezigaba ezintathu, amandla amanje, aphumayo, nawo wonke amapharamitha wesilawuli samandla angaboniswa esikrinini esithintwayo.Kulula kakhulu ukusebenza.
Izinga lokushisa elibekiwe kanye nezinga lokushisa eliqondiwe likalwa imitha yokulawula izinga lokushisa, futhi ukulawulwa kwe-loop evaliwe kwenziwa ngempendulo yesignali engu-4-20mA kusilawuli samandla.Isilawuli samandla silawulwa nge-engeli yesigaba ukuze sihlangabezane nezidingo zamakhasimende.Ingakwazi ukulawula ukuphuma kwesilawuli samandla e-scr ngezindlela ezintathu, i-voltage engaguquki, yamanje, amandla angashintshi.Noma iyiphi imodi, izokwenza okukhiphayo kuzinze kakhulu.
